Revolutionizing Healthcare Finance: The Growth of Revenue Cycle Management



The global revenue cycle management (RCM) market, valued at approximately $61.11 billion in 2025, is on track to expand to $105.35 billion by 2030, showcasing a remarkable annual growth rate of 11.5%. This explosive growth can be attributed to the increasing adoption of AI-enhanced, cloud-based RCM platforms, which streamline financial workflows, enhance compliance, and alleviate administrative burdens for healthcare providers.

The Benefits of Modern RCM Solutions


Modern RCM solutions tackle numerous challenges while transforming revenue management in hospitals and clinics. Here are some key benefits:

  • - Eligibility Verification: Automated processes simplify verifying patient eligibility and benefits.
  • - Denial Management: Real-time analytics help mitigate denial issues and improve the overall revenue outcome.
  • - Interoperable Systems: Advanced RCM tools are designed to function seamlessly with Electronic Health Records (EHRs) to provide comprehensive oversight of financial transactions.

For instance, platforms like Optum's AI-driven suite leverage predictive analytics and automation to boost patient collections and minimize claim denials. Additionally, Oracle's Health Cloud consolidates financial and clinical data, promoting a transparent revenue cycle experience.

Addressing Key Healthcare Challenges


The implementation of RCM solutions effectively addresses several persistent pain points within the healthcare industry:

  • - Streamlined Billing and Coding: Intelligent automation facilitates precise billing and coding, reducing manual errors.
  • - Regulatory Compliance: Built-in compliance features ensure adherence to industry standards such as ICD-10 and HL7 FHIR.
  • - Enhanced Cash Flow: By optimizing claims submissions and accelerating reimbursements, RCM significantly improves cash flow for healthcare facilities.
  • - Enhanced Patient Financial Experiences: Self-service portals and real-time cost estimates empower patients by providing clear financial information.

A Global Adoption Trend


The acceleration of RCM adoption is witnessing momentum in both developed and emerging markets. Noteworthy advancements include:

  • - United Kingdom: By late 2023, 90% of NHS hospital trusts adopted Electronic Patient Records (EPR), paving the way for integrated RCM solutions.
  • - India: The Union Budget for 2024-25 allocated $10.7 billion for healthcare advancements focusing on digital infrastructure.
